As part of Internews’ Earth Journalism Network’s Media for Inclusive Green Growth in Nepal (MIGG) project, 42 journalists have been selected for a fellowship and mentorship program to report on Natural Resource Management (NRM) and green growth. 

EJN and our partner Nepal Forum of Environmental Journalists (NEFEJ) have implemented the MIGG project since 2024, with support from the European Delegation to Nepal. To boost environmental coverage, 42 fellows were selected through an open-competitive application process. The first 20 fellowships were awarded in November 2024, the remaining 22 were awarded in April 2025.

The selected journalists, of which 22 are women, represent each of the seven provinces of Nepal.
